Automatically Calculate Selling Fee / Commission

Hello,

Is it possible to have line items on a sales invoice such as selling fee and commission that is based on the subtotal of items sold and not based just on the last item entered. As per the image attached, I would like fees and commissions based on $510.00 and not the last item entered ($210.00).

Automatically Calculate Selling Fee / Commission

Yes, it's possible, JR. I'll guide you on how to do it.

 

You can add a subtotal item after Lladro-1415, so the calculation for the fee and the commission will be based on the sub-total amount. To do this, just add a new item from the Invoice page, select the Subtotal type and name it as Subtotal.

 

 

The outcome will look like this:

 

If you want to check the total commission for a certain period, you can go to your chart of accounts. Then, run a quick report of the account that is associated with your commission item.

We'd like to do this as well, but on QB Online. What are the steps for QBO?

The information provided by my colleague above is unavailable in QuickBooks Online. The ability to set up a line item for selling fee and commission that is based on subtotal hasn't been made available in QuickBooks Online.
